When can I re-apply for a job after leaving Cognizant?

When can I re-apply for a job after leaving Cognizant?

If there is an open position that matches your interests and skill-set, you can re-apply whenever you want. The process is the same regardless of your having worked at Cognizant. You can search for a job and apply, or join a talent community to upload your resume.

What is the place of posting after joining Cognizant as a fresher?

There’s a GWFM (Global work force management) team in Cognizant where you can discuss your about your place of posting after joining as a fresher (PAT) post completion of your training. But it depends on the requirement in the projects at your desired location.

How much does it cost to work with a cognizant agency?

Cognizant does not charge a fee at any stage of the recruitment process and has not authorized any agencies or partners to collect any fee for recruitment. Our core values include integrity and transparency.

Where is cognizant based?

It is headquartered in Teaneck, New Jersey, United States. Cognizant is listed in the NASDAQ-100 and the S&P 500 indices. It was founded as an in-house technology unit of Dun & Bradstreet in 1994, and started serving external clients in 1996. [Source : Wikipedia]

Can I apply for multiple positions at Cognizant?

At Cognizant, we believe each individual brings multiple strengths and talents that can make a difference to our customers. So, give yourself the flexibility to apply for multiple open positions that you feel you bring the qualifications to succeed at those positions. Can I apply for a position across multiple geographical locations? Yes, you can.
